Marlins manager Don Mattingly has tested positive for COVID-19, the team announced (MLB.com’s Christina De Nicola was among those to report the news). Mattingly is experiencing some mild symptoms but has been vaccinated against the coronavirus. Bench coach James Rowson will serve as acting manager while Mattingly is absent for the mandatory quarantine period. Tests of other Marlins personnel revealed no other positive cases.
